All protein ultimately originates from plants, as plants synthesize amino acids from atmospheric nitrogen through symbiotic relationships with soil bacteria; all plant proteins contain all essential amino acids, making complementary protein combining unnecessary, and research demonstrates that plant-based diets provide adequate protein while being associated with lower risks of chronic diseases compared to animal protein consumption.
